私たちのソフトウェアをインストールするのを手伝っているつもりです。ソフトウェアの設定はInnoSetupを使って行い、ParallelsとWindows XPを搭載したMac Proにインストールします。インストール中に、InnoSetupがで失敗します。InnoSetupがMacにインストールされているWin XPで「My Documents」を見つけることができません
InnoSetupでInternal error: Failed to expand shell folder constant "userdocs"
、{userdocs}は、「マイドキュメント」フォルダにマップし、InnoSetupは、Delphiで書かれている通り、私はそれがこのフォルダを取得するために、CSIDL_PERSONALまたはCSIDL_MYDOCUMENTSを使用していますと仮定しますしかし、私はこれらの場所を修正する方法を知らない。
誰でもこれまでに遭遇したことはありますか?もしそうなら、それを修正する方法を知っていますか?
ありがとうございます!
解決済み:XPのインストールがうまくいっているとユーザーが主張した後、指定した「マイドキュメント」フォルダが存在しないことが明らかになりました。私はXPを再インストールする必要があると提案しましたが、フォルダの場所を存在させるためにTweakUIを使うというMSalterの提案にも合格しました。 –